Transaction 31345fca424c4ad7e716aaed291320ed7a6d95e011fc2bde22866523ee3d3c38
1 Input
2 Outputs
- 31345fca424c4ad7e716aaed291320ed7a6d95e011fc2bde22866523ee3d3c38:0
- 31345fca424c4ad7e716aaed291320ed7a6d95e011fc2bde22866523ee3d3c38:1
value 5000000
address 159k7HMGZR6zZvCnwzHFebj3yQ6PTYArGT
value 104934578
address 38wFgzeq1gDm5s8XXYvAoGrpXumXYop9xs